Anybody with a 11-87 Should try a kicks gobblin Thunder choke as well. I shoot the 1 5/8 oz. Load of TSS 9s and the kicks .570 is nasty in my gun. Mine has a 26" barrel, and has shot a high of 362 if I remember correctly in the 10" at 40 yards. It averages around 330 in the 10" and puts around 200 in the 10" to 20" ring. I need to dig the patterns up and post pics here. I have tried a lot of chokes in testing, such as PG, Rhino, RSF, IC, etc. And the kicks beats them all.

The Steel and TSS combo, is it 50%-50%?
I am going to get out a limb (thick, oak and am sitting against the trunk) and guess that the larger holes are steel shot. :)

It's 1/4 oz of the small TSS 9s with 3/4 oz of steel 3s. It's running about 1500 fps, but it's over SAAMI MAP at that speed.

Derrick counted 93 TSS pellets and 101 steel pellets in the circle.
